Job Description

The Principal Compliance Specialist – Compliance Testing and Monitoring Strategy is responsible for assisting with the administration and execution of the Testing and Monitoring Strategy Program within Corporate Compliance. The program is designed to promote compliance with applicable laws and regulations by facilitating early identification and effective mitigation of compliance risk. The principal compliance specialist will assist with developing, implementing, and maintaining the Program which includes providing on-going support to the shared services risk testing team. The position requires experience in the design and execution of compliance testing and reporting, as well as regulatory compliance knowledge.

Responsibilities 

  • Participate in the development of a multi-year compliance test plan and refresh annually to align with Compliance Risk Assessment.
  • Assist Enterprise Risk Testing regarding scope for scheduled compliance reviews.
  • Provide compliance advisory support during fieldwork to Enterprise Risk Testing to ensure proper understanding of regulatory requirements and testing is adequately designed to identify non-compliance with laws and regulations.
  • Assist with finalizing findings including effective challenge of root cause analysis and corrective action plans and assignment of risk ratings.
  • Assist with the development and maintenance of applicable Program documentation and procedures.
  • Assist with on-going reporting of progress against test plan, findings, and associated management resolution efforts.
  • Conduct meetings with stakeholders and other internal partners to review progress regarding annual compliance test plan and align on other related topics as needed.
